Temporary work design: the line
Abstract The jacking load is the force required to advance the complete pipe train after, or during, excavation of soil at the tunnel face. The load is a combination of face resistance to penetration of the shield, and frictional force on the following pipeline. It is important that jacking forces can be accurately predicted in practice to enable the operation to be designed appropriately.
